Kashubian[edit]

Etymology[edit]

Inherited from Proto-Slavic *pàdati.

Pronunciation[edit]

  • IPA(key): /ˈpadat͡s/
  • Hyphenation: pa‧dac

Verb[edit]

padac impf

  1. (intransitive) to fall

Lushootseed[edit]

Etymology[edit]

From Proto-Salish *ʔupan.

Pronunciation[edit]

Numeral[edit]

padac

  1. (Southern Lushootseed) ten
    Synonym: (Northern Lushootseed) ʔulub
